Equipment Fabricator Position Summary:

Reporting to the Shop Manager, this position plays an integral role in our manufacturing operation and includes functions such as machining, assembly, machine troubleshooting, repair and maintenance.

Position Responsibilities:

- Ensuring safe work practices at all times is critical to success at Fer-Pal

- Manual machining parts to specifications, interpreting drawings, proper use of lathes, mills, drill press, hand tools and other machine shop related tools.

- Cut, fit, fasten, secure, assemble - frames, structures, sheets of wood, metal, plastic

- Safe operation of powered hand tools, drills, grinders, skill-saw, table saw, miter saw.

- Work on machine assembly, equipment building, maintenance, testing of new equipment

- Fabrication of frames, brackets, custom components made of metals, plastics, wood

- Carry out maintenance related activities, assist in maintaining / repairing robotic devices, motors, winch assemblies, other machines.

- Ability to work with minimal supervision at Fer-Pal facility as well as at customer facilities and other work site environments.

- Work with manufacturing/maintenance team to complete projects within tight deadlines, with quality craftsmanship.

- Ability to maintain good housekeeping practices.

Position Requirements:

- 4-5 years of experience working in a machine shop or fabrication shop environment

- MUST have experience with machines and power tools

- MUST be able to work with and understand mechanical and electrical components.

- Post secondary diploma preferred

- Good experience and work ethic with secondary school completion will be considered

- Flexibility to work extended shifts, including evenings or weekends.

- MUST have good communication skills, work ethic, Team player with positive attitude.
